UNITED INS. v. OFFICE OF INS. REGULATION

No. 1D07-4059.

985 So.2d 665 (2008)

UNITED INSURANCE COMPANY OF AMERICA, Appellant, v. OFFICE OF INSURANCE REGULATION, State Of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, First District.

June 30, 2008.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

J. Riley Davis of Akerman Senterfitt, Tallahassee, for Appellant.

S. Marc Herskovitz, Division of Legal Services, Office of Insurance Regulation, Tallahassee, for Appellee.


BARFIELD, J.

United Insurance Company of America (United) appeals a final order of the Florida Office of Insurance Regulation denying its application to include a mandatory arbitration agreement within its life insurance contracts. We affirm.

United sells life insurance in Florida. On March 1, 2006, United sought to amend its approved life insurance contract by adding an arbitration provision. The request was disapproved by the Office of Insurance Regulation...
